Transaction 81df8a0b5a87f209bdfac52918aa30de358f0ccb34215ae435d230ea7baf1870

1 Input
1 Outputs
  • 81df8a0b5a87f209bdfac52918aa30de358f0ccb34215ae435d230ea7baf1870:0
  • value  45453178
    address  bc1q52a6zya3xk9wg27ns9372rz7023pw7z23r3j5y